Candlelight March Held in Assar to Honor Bus Accident Victims
DODA, NOVEMBER 16: In a heartfelt tribute to the victims of the tragic bus accident at Trungal Morh, Assar, a solemn candlelight march was organized under the guidance of SDM Assar, Ashok Kumar. The devastating incident claimed 38 precious lives, leaving the community in deep sorrow.
The march commenced from the Tehsil Office and culminated at the SDM Office on November 15, 2024, at 5:00 PM, with residents from across the region uniting to pay homage to the departed souls and stand in solidarity with their grieving families.
